Ardglass retain Pat Sharvin Cup - 06th June 2005


ARDGLASS RETAIN PAT SHARVIN CUP

Ardglass retained the Pat Sharvin cup on sunday evening after easily seeing of their hosts Kilclief.The home side could'nt contain the talents of Ardgass' teenage talents Laim mullan,Mickey Magee and Matthew Rooney.While team captain Chris Deegan dominated the midfield sector and his brother Stephen controlled the defence throughout.The final margin of seven points was only kept down by Kilclief's netminder Steenson making a string of fine saves and Kieran Polly's long range free taking

The reserves had a comfortable 11 point win over Carryduff after a poor first half a Benny Magee goal brought ardglass to within two points of carryduff at the break.In the second half the experinced Chris polly switched to midfield and this swung the game in Ardglass' favour as Ardglass piled on the scores carryduff were held scoreless in the last quarter of the game

The u-12s lost to Loughinisland in the east down championship in a competive game Shane Taggart and Mark Deegans were the best players for Ardglass. The u-14s lost to Tecconnaght in the league by 3 points. Goals from Conall Feenan and Stephen Rooney kept Ardglass in the game but they were'nt enough to finish teconnaught off. The u-16s also lost at home to drumaness in another close game Martin halpin and Philip Curran played well along with Mark Armstrong
